मुने पुनः प्रसन्नोस्मि वरं ब्रूहि ददामि ते
O sage, I am pleased with you again; ask for a boon, I shall grant it to you.
आदावेव हि तिष्ठासुरहमत्र तपोनिधे
From the very beginning, O treasure of austerity, I have wished to remain here.
प्राप्य काशीं सुदुर्मेधाः कस्त्यजेज्ज्ञानवान्यदि
Who, possessing wisdom, would abandon Kashi after attaining it, unless their intellect is greatly deluded?
अल्पीयसा श्रमेणेह वपुषो व्ययमात्रतः
Here, with only a little effort, merely by the exhaustion of the body,
विनिमय्य जराजीर्णं देहं पार्थिवमत्र वै
Exchanging this aged and worn-out earthly body here,
न तपोभिर्न वा दानैर्न यज्ञैर्बहुदक्षिणैः
Not by austerities, nor by gifts, nor by sacrifices with many fees,
अपि योगं हि युंजाना योगिनो यतमानसाः
Even yogis striving earnestly, practicing yoga,
इदमेव महादानमिदमेव महत्तपः
This alone is the great gift, this alone is the supreme austerity.
स एव विद्वाञ्जगति स एव विजितेंद्रियः 4.2.60.
He alone is wise in the world, he alone has conquered his senses.
तावत्स्थास्याम्यहं चात्र यावत्काशी मुने त्विह
O sage, I shall remain here as long as Kashi exists.
इत्याकर्ण्य गिरं विष्णोरग्निबिंदुर्महामुनिः
Hearing these words of Vishnu, Agnibindu, the great sage,
मापते मम नाम्नात्र तीर्थे पंचनदे शुभे
Let this holy place at the Five Rivers be known by my name, O lord.
येत्र पंचनदे स्नात्वा गत्वा देशांतरेष्वपि
Whoever, having bathed in the Five Rivers, goes even to other lands,
येतु पंचनदे स्नात्वा त्वां भजिष्यंति मानवाः
Those men who, having bathed in the Five Rivers, worship you,
त्वन्नाम्नोऽर्धेन मे नाम मया सह भविष्यति
By half of your name, my name shall be joined with mine.
बिंदुमाधव इत्याख्या मम त्रैलोक्यविश्रुता
The designation 'Bindumadhava' shall be mine, renowned throughout the three worlds.
ये मामत्र नराः पुण्याः पुण्ये पंचनदे ह्रदे
Those virtuous men who worship me here, at the sacred lake of the Five Rivers,
वसुस्वरूपिणी लक्ष्मीर्लक्ष्मीर्निर्वाणसंज्ञिका
Lakshmi, in the form of wealth, and Lakshmi known as Nirvana,
यैर्न पंचनदं प्राप्य वसुभिः प्रीणिता द्विजाः 4.2.60.
Those twice-born who, having reached the Five Rivers, have pleased the Vasus,
त एव धन्या लोकेस्मिन्कृतकृत्यास्त एव हि
They alone are blessed in this world, they alone have fulfilled their purpose.
बिंदुतीर्थमिदं नाम तव नाम्ना भविष्यति
This holy place shall be called Bindutirtha, bearing your name.
